Commencing in 1884, the region was break up among two colonial powers. Germany dominated the northern fifty percent of the place for a number of many years for a colony named German New Guinea, whilst the southern A part of the country turned a British protectorate.
These ailments contributed for the complexity of organising the region's submit-independence lawful procedure.
Japan invaded New Guinea in 1941 and arrived at Papua the subsequent 12 months. Allied victories over the New Guinea campaign pushed out the Japanese, and once the finish on the war, Australia put together the two territories into a single administration. Sir Michael SOMARE gained elections in 1972 within the guarantee of reaching independence, which was understood in 1975.

The very first inhabitants Indigenous men and women of recent Guinea, from whom the Papuan folks are most likely descended, adapted for the variety of ecologies and, in time, made on the list of earliest recognised agricultures. Continues to be of the agricultural procedure, in the form of historical irrigation units while in the highlands of Papua New Guinea, are now being analyzed by archaeologists.
Three new species of mammals have been identified while in the forests of Papua New Guinea by an Australian-led expedition in the early 2010s. A small wallaby, a significant-eared mouse plus a shrew-like marsupial have been found out. The expedition was also successful in capturing photos and online video tour guide footage of some other exceptional animals like the Tenkile tree kangaroo and also the Weimang tree kangaroo.[fifty nine] Nearly a person-quarter of Papua New Guinea's rainforests were damaged or destroyed amongst 1972 and 2002.
Papua lies inside the Australian faunal region, which implies that its animal daily life is a lot more just like that of Australia and New Zealand than it truly is to that of western Indonesia as well as the Southeast Asian mainland. Noteworthy mammals include things like marsupials, like tree kangaroos and cuscuses; monotremes (egg-laying mammals), which include many types of echidnas; plus a wide variety of bats, terrestrial rats, and drinking water rats.
The "fundamental legislation" (Papua New Guinea's frequent law) includes principles and rules of common regulation and fairness in English[79] typical law mainly because it stood on 16 September 1975 (the day of independence), and thereafter the choices of PNG's possess courts. The Constitution directs the courts and, latterly, the Underlying Regulation Act to consider Observe of the "custom made" of standard communities. They may be to determine which customs are common to The full country and may also be declared to generally be Section of the underlying regulation.
Australian soldiers resting inside the Finisterre Ranges of latest Guinea even though en path to the front line Netherlands New Guinea along with the Australian territories (the japanese 50 percent ) ended up invaded in 1942 because of the Japanese. The Netherlands were being defeated by that phase and didn't place up a battle, along with the western area was not of any strategic worth to either side, so they didn't struggle there. The Japanese invaded the north shore of your Australia territories and were being aiming to maneuver south and go ahead and take southern shore also.
